Population, work and organisational change research at LUSEM

Research in this theme focuses on demographic processes, labour markets, and organisational dynamics. It includes studies of employment, unemployment, and labour markets, as well as analyses of organisational change and adaptation.

Demographic processes such as fertility and migration form another important strand, examining population change and its implications for work and organisations.
